Which Ford Fiesta models have heated seats?

The Ford Fiesta, a popular subcompact car, offers heated seats as an optional feature on select models. The availability of heated seats can vary depending on the specific Fiesta trim level and model year.


Ford Fiesta Heated Seat Options


According to the information gathered from various sources, the following Ford Fiesta models have been available with heated seats:



  • Ford Fiesta Titanium - Heated front seats have been offered as an optional feature on the Titanium trim level, which is the top-of-the-line Fiesta model.

  • Ford Fiesta ST-Line - The sportier ST-Line trim has also been available with optional heated front seats.

  • Ford Fiesta Vignale - The premium Vignale trim, introduced in 2017, has included heated front seats as a standard feature.


It's important to note that the availability of heated seats may have varied by model year and market, so the specific options may have changed over time. Customers should always check the features and options available for the particular Fiesta model and trim level they are interested in.


Heated Seat Functionality


The heated seats in the Ford Fiesta are typically controlled through the vehicle's infotainment system or climate control panel. Drivers can adjust the level of heat, with most systems offering multiple heat settings to provide the desired level of warmth.


Heated seats can be a valuable feature, especially in colder climates, as they help provide comfort and warmth to the driver and front passenger during chilly weather conditions.

What year did cars have heated seats?


1966
The 1966 Cadillac Fleetwood was the first model to feature heated seats. The technology behind heated seats is similar to the tech features in hairdryers, electric blankets, and water heaters. A long strip of heating material, called a heating element, serves as the resistor, resisting the electrical flow.

What model of Fiesta has heated seats?


Ford Fiesta Active X
One of the earlier Active variants, this high-spec trim level adds things like part-leather upholstery, heated front seats, sat-nav and digital climate control. Other car tech includes keyless entry, cruise control, rear parking sensors and a reversing camera.
